Question
Explain in brief any three means, by which a consumer can be protected.

Answer

Three means of consumer protection are:
  1. Self-regulation by business: Enlightened business firms realise that it is in their long-term interest to serve the customers well. For this, they usually set up their customer services and redessal cells.
  2. Business associations: Associations of trade, commerce and business like CII and FICCI lay down the code of conduct for their members for dealing with customers.
  3. Government: The government can protect the consumers interest by enacting various legislations.
